Output 3b4815bdefb683c2504337f3a60bc415166a37a6b563f2b31dfd288e546247ca:2

value
697883284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e909f51cdbc4d1c69f2724751c8c0391a0170c58 OP_EQUAL
address
3NwDJ6cEWeTnFUSSYfhR1tmS9RKJvJDtWT
transaction
3b4815bdefb683c2504337f3a60bc415166a37a6b563f2b31dfd288e546247ca
confirmations
493882
spent
true